Artificial intelligence (AI) has recently transformed how the banking industry manages online security to protect sensitive customer information. However, AI has also introduced new threats for bank customers. Fraudsters have learned how to utilize AI-powered tools to exploit vulnerabilities in financial institutions and their customers. Learn the key risks, including online security breaches, deepfakes, robocalls, bank account takeovers, and social media scams.
As AI advances, so do cyber threats. Therefore, it’s critical to stay vigilant against AI-driven fraud. Although AI enhances many financial institutions’ services, improves fraud detection, and personalizes customer experiences, it can also be employed to obtain your personal information. Install new software updates to ensure you have the latest security patches for any identified vulnerabilities.
If you receive a suspicious call asking for your account or personal information, hang up and contact us immediately.
Always verify the identity of anyone who contacts you and asks for your personal or account information.
Fraudsters use deepfake technology to trick you into authorizing transactions or disclosing your sensitive information, and they even prompt you to respond by saying “Yes” and gaining your voiceprint for deepfake scams. With the help of technology, scammers create realistic yet fraudulent images, audio, and videos impersonating you.
Verify the identity of anyone asking for personal information — including your name — and be wary of unexpected video calls or emails requesting sensitive details.
Scammers use automated robocalls every day to attempt to sell you something or — worse yet — get you to share your personal information by impersonating a bank employee. In these calls, fraudsters often claim there is an urgent issue with your account, and they need sensitive information like your password or Social Security Number to resolve the issue.
If you receive a suspicious call asking for these or similar details, hang up and contact us immediately. Popular Bank representatives never ask for sensitive personal information over the phone.
Cybercriminals use scam tactics like phishing, malware, social engineering, and malicious emails to gain unauthorized access to your bank account. Once they take over, they can transfer funds, change your account details, and even lock you out.
The best way to protect yourself against bank account takeovers is to enable multi-factor authentication, use strong passwords, and regularly monitor your transactions.
Popular Bank will never ask for personal or account information over social media. However, scammers often use these platforms to pose as bank representatives and attempt to access your account via fake promotions or unrequested customer support.
Fraudsters typically ask for personal details or direct you to fake websites to enter your sensitive information.
